Ok, so I’ve never seen the movie and I’ve never read any of the comics. Now, I’ve watched other Marvel movies, so I have an idea who Thanos is and the gems. But everything else is new to me. I don’t know who all the players are like Nebula, Gamora, Tivan and someone named Ronan, but I’m sure it’ll come together eventually. I only enjoyed 3 of the 7 offerings in this volume. That includes story and artwork.

For Prelude 1 & 2 and the last one, Dangerous Prey, I give 5’s to story and artwork. I love the artwork so much! It’s gorgeous! I can’t stand the artwork for the middle stories (Beware the Blood Brothers, The Power of Warlock, Rocket Raccoon and the Groot one) and the plots are meh. I can’t even tell what the actual titles are because there’s stuff written everywhere. They’re confusing and the artwork is too garish, simplistic, busy and comic-booky. Blerg.
